Join Barclays as a Software Engineer - Network Automation role, where this role is ideal for engineers who are strong Python developers, enjoy solving infrastructure and networking problems through software, and want to grow their skills across microservices, platform engineering, and automation. At Barclays, we don't just anticipate the future - we're creating it.

To be successful in this role, you should have below skills:

  • Strong hands on Python development experience, with a clear software engineering mindset (clean code, modular design, testability, and maintainability).

  • Experience building software products using Python, not just scripts, including packaging, dependency management, and versioning.

  • Good understanding of Micro Services architecture, API driven design, and service to service integrations.

  • Experience with network device integration and automation using technologies such as Netconf/Restconf/Yang, YAML/Json, Jinja, Parsers, Netmiko or similar.

  • Working knowledge of secure coding basics, error handling, and defensive programming practices.

Domain skills

  • Strong networking fundamentals (CCNA or similar), including core routing, switching, firewall, load-balancing and troubleshooting concepts.

  • Exposure to virtualization and infrastructure environments is preferred

Some other highly valued skills may include below:

  • Experience working in Kubernetes and containerized environments.

  • Exposure to SRE concepts, including SLIs/SLOs and observability using ELK, Grafana, or similar tools.

  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ines and modern DevOps practices.

What We Do

Barclays is a British universal bank. We are diversified by business, by different types of customers and clients, and by geography. Our businesses include consumer banking and payments operations around the world, as well as a top-tier, full service, global corporate and investment bank, all of which are supported by our service company which provides technology, operations and functional services across the Group. With over 325 years of history and expertise in banking, Barclays operates in over 40 countries and employs approximately 83,500 people. Barclays moves, lends, invests and protects money for customers and clients worldwide.
